Heads For The Dead – Never Ending Night Of Terror

Genre: Death Metal
Country: Sweden / Germany / United Kingdom / United States
Label: Pulverised Records
Year: 2025

Heads For The Dead’s eagerly anticipated fourth album, Never Ending Night Of Terror, marks a thrilling new chapter for the band since their 2023 EP In The Absence Of Faith. This release also continues their partnership with Pulverised Records, their label since 2023.

Vocalist Ralf Hauber, known from Revel In Flesh and Rotpit, describes the album as an “overall more extreme” experience, amplifying the band’s signature sound in every aspect. The album’s ten tracks carry a focused, intense cinematic vibe inspired by cult slasher classics such as David Cronenberg’s Videodrome, Roman Polanski’s Repulsion, the original Friday the 13th, Stuart Gordon’s The Beyond and Re-Animator, and others like Motel Hell and City Of The Dead. This thematic core of revenge, violence, and pervasive fear permeates both lyrics and music.

Multi-instrumentalist Jonny Petterson composed the entire album, drawing heavy influence from iconic horror soundtracks and the ominous tones of Necrophagia. Hauber wrote all the lyrics, weaving the essence of these horror films with additional fictional elements to deepen the storytelling. The current line-up, solid since 2022, features Matt Moliti from Sentient Horror on lead guitar and introduces Evan Daniele from Sentient Horror and Dead and Dripping on drums.

Italian artist Solo Macello, a self-professed horror movie fanatic with credits including Pentagram and Zakk Sabbath, crafted the album artwork for the first time. The imagery reflects both Jonny and Ralf’s vision, with the main slasher figure’s mask supposedly inspired by an actual horror mask in Jonny’s living room. This eerie design cleverly nods to Sodom’s mascot, presenting an ominous “evil-twin” figure.

Adding tribute to horror’s legacy, the band includes an original track paying homage to Goblin, the Italian prog rock legends behind the Suspiria soundtrack. Attentive listeners may catch subtle references to the film’s haunting main theme woven into the music.

The album delivers around 41 minutes of intense, brutal, and aggressive death metal across ten tracks, including a tribute to the Italian horror film Suspiria. The album combines heavy, ferocious riffs with dark synths and haunting melodies, creating a macabre and terrifying atmosphere that evokes classic horror motifs and films.

The vocal delivery is guttural and raw, matched by intense drumming and sharp guitar work. The horror elements are not just thematic but are deeply embedded in the music, giving the album distinct personality and immersion. Songs like the title track “Never Ending Night of Terror” stand out with their off-kilter, dark atmospheric qualities, and the band skillfully balances brutality with melodic hooks and passages that enhance the eerie vibe.

Never Ending Night Of Terror is a refined evolution for Heads for the Dead, showcasing their growth and niche in blending Swedish-style death metal with horror cinema influences. It is highly recommended for fans of death metal that crave a blend of aggression, atmosphere, and cinematic horror flair. The album successfully merges the raw power of death metal with a sinister, horror-inspired narrative, making it a memorable and impactful release in the genre.
